Seminars on child rights, sexual abuse, trafficking and protection have been conducted at Manarat International University. A seminar titled 'Red Heart Campaign to Promote Child Rights of Sexually Abused, Exploited and Trafficked Children' was held on Sunday (May 26) in the conference room of Gulshan campus of the university.
Manarat International University organized this seminar in collaboration with Sexual Violence Prevention Cell Center for Women and Children Studies. Member of the Board of Trustees of the University and Associate Professor of the National Institute of Mental Health Dr. Mekhla Sarkar was present as the chief guest. University Vice-Chancellor (Acting) Professor Dr. was present as a special guest. Muhammad Abduch Chabur Khan. Dean of the School of Engineering, Science and Technology and convener of the University's Sexual Abuse Prevention Cell. Professor Ishrat Shamim, president of Center for Women and Children Studies, gave a welcome speech in the seminar presided over by Nargis Sultana Chowdhury.
The chief guest at the seminar was Dr. Mekhla Sarkar urged the parents to be aware and said that you should keep an eye on where your child is staying, with whom he is talking and mixing. Children should be taught from an early age what contact is good and what is bad. Only then all unwanted incidents like sexual abuse will be reduced from the society.
He encouraged the students to focus on their studies, join cultural activities, play sports and socialize with people, saying that university time is a place for learning as well as intellectual development. You have to prepare from here on how to deal with the difficult reality that is coming in front of you after your studies.
Professor Dr. in the speech of the special guest. Muhammad Abduch Chabur Khan urged to reduce the dependence on devices to prevent sexual harassment and torture and said that device dependence is responsible in many cases for the unwanted incidents that girls are subjected to including sexual abuse. So, you have to trust and rely on someone after being aware and vetting carefully to minimize device dependency.
Ana Lucia Sandoval Orozco, an international researcher on child rights from Madrid, Spain, and Zooey Culpert, Europe program manager of the International Center for Missing and Exploited Children from the United States, participated in the virtual seminar.
